Local Priorities

Anti-social behaviour was voted for as priority in a recent community survey, the Denham and Gerrards Cross neighbourhood team will continue to take steps to prevent and respond to anti-social behaviour. Anti-social behaviour includes issues such as drugs, littering, noise disturbances and youth anti-social behaviour.

Issued: 1 Apr 2026

Status Update

The neighbourhood policing team continue to tackle anti-social behaviour.

On the weekend of the 08/02/2026 we responded to reports of pony and trap racing on the A413 between Chalfont St Peter and Denham. Working alongside our response officer colleagues robust action was taken in relation to several driving offences being committed. In total, two vehicles were seized and five people were reported for a range of offences. In addition a further individual stopped as part of this response was found to be wanted by another police force and was promptly arrested.

Speeding has been identified as a priority for local residents, they have reported that high speeds across the area represent a risk to community safety.

Issued: 1 Apr 2026

Status Update

In January we carried out a speed check on Windsor Road, Gerrards Cross during which four drivers were stopped and issued with warnings and two others were reported. Our Special Constabulary have also been out supporting this work in the Gerrards Cross area and reported three further drivers for exceeding 30mph limits.

On 04/04/2026 our colleagues in Roads Policing completed enforcement activity on the A4020 Oxford Road, New Denham. Five drivers were reported for exceeding the limit, one was reported for lamp offences and another for driving without MOT.

On 13/04/2026 the neighbourhood team completed further enforcement activity on Windsor Road, Gerrards Cross. One driver was warned and three others were stopped, reported and now face speed awareness courses or penalty points and fines. The highest speed recorded was 43mph.

Burglary was voted as a top priority for the residents of Denham and Gerrards cross, Bucks TVP have recently started their winter burglary campaign.

Issued: 1 Apr 2026

Status Update

The neighbourhood policing team have been working hard over the last three months to combat burglary. We have supported wider operations such as Operation Grotto and Operation Pandilla, both of which saw intense proactivity across the Chalfonts, Gerrards Cross, Denham and Iver. These operations resulted in multiple arrests, stop searches, vehicle searches and some excellent disruption.
